Factors Influencing Cost
Replacing cedar shingles in Randolph, MA involves selecting appropriate materials, understanding the scope of work, and navigating local permitting requirements. This overview provides information to help evaluate typical project considerations and compare options for cedar shingle replacement projects.
- Materials: Standard cedar shingles are available in various grades and sizes, typically measuring 18" to 24" in length and 5" to 7" in width, with options for pressure-treated or untreated wood.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small sections of siding to full roof replacements, depending on the extent of damage or desired aesthetic update.
- Labor Complexity: The installation process involves precise nailing and layering techniques, with complexity increasing for steep roofs or intricate architectural features.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Randolph, MA may require permits for roofing or siding replacements, especially for larger projects or structural modifications.
- Additional Considerations: Optional extras may include underlayment upgrades, ventilation improvements, or protective finishes to extend the lifespan of the shingles.
